This paper provides a critical assessment of the motivations behind South Africa’s active participation in the Open Government Partnership (OGP) and their absence from the Extractive Industries Transparency Initiative (EITI). It suggests that the South African government may be more responsive to EITI-membership appeals if it perceives that its aspirations as an emerging power, both regionally and globally, are better acknowledged.
